Wasmtime hangs when doing file I/O in a multi threaded app #8392

Executing a wasm application on wasmtime that has multiple threads where on thread does file I/O results in a hang on the first file I/O operation.

Test Case

Clone https://github.com/dbaeumer/wasm-threads.git

Steps to Reproduce

  • npm run build:wasm to build the wasm file
  • npm run run:wasmtime to execute the wasm file in wasmtime

Expected Results

The application doesn't hang on the fs::File::open call

I expect the same result as executing:

npm run build:os
npm run run:os

Actual Results

The application does hang.
